Southland College (SC) or Southland College of Kabankalan, Inc. is a private, non-sectarian and coeducational institution located in the fast progressive City of Kabankalan, Negros Occidental, Philippines.

Established in March 2009, the school is one of the newest in the Philippines[1] however majority of its administrators, faculty and staff have working experience and qualification comparable to those older institutions in the country. Southland College offers education for pre-school, grade school, high school, college. Though non-sectarian, the school anchored its values formation on Biblical truths and teachings.

History

Deeply saddened by the anticipated mass resignation of the faculty and staff with the change of leadership of a private school where he was the former president, Dr. Anecito D. Villaluz Jr.[2] decided to put up his own school where he could freely make use of his publicly acknowledged and admired managerial skills and organizational expertise.

The preparations for the new school started in March 2009. The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) issued the school registration permit on March 24, 2009. The Department of Education (DepEd) Western Visayas regional office issued the permit for the basic education on June 1, 2009. The school established a consortium with the Negros Oriental State University (NORSU) for degree programs, namely: BS Accountancy, BS Accounting Technology, BS Business Administration, BS Hospitality Management, and the 2-year Midwifery course. The Regional Quality Assessment Team (RQUAT) and Commission on Higher Education (CHED) supervisors readily issued permits for all degree programs after validating the requirements and inspecting the facilities. The school was formally launched on May 13, 2009. It was followed by a grand caravan. The following days saw the advertisements and promotions blitz in various towns and cities.

A thanksgiving service with the theme “Triumph Amid Trials” was held on August 28, 2009 morning. It was immediately followed by the school’s very first academic convocation. The officers of student councils, faculty and staff club, and the parents and teachers assemblies were inducted in the afternoon. Acquaintance parties in all levels followed.

With the fast-paced establishment of the school was without no controversy, especially smear and false information disseminated by those critical of the school particularly on the matters of permit to operate different programs, but the school complied and was inspected by authorities thus granted a permit and even assurance to its students in all of its programs, on November 2009 The School of Basic Education was given Government Recognition then followed by the Diploma in Midwifery in November 2010.

The school invested a college complex[3] with modern classroom convenience and facilities to cater the needs of its students, the construction commenced last March 2010 and finished in August 2012.
